在Delphi编程环境中,TreeView控件常用于展示层次结构数据,而SQL则用于数据库操作。将讨论如何在Delphi中利用TreeView控件展示来自SQL数据库的数据。TreeView是Delphi的标准控件,支持树形结构,适合展示数据库层次关系。SQL是用于管理关系型数据库的语言,可通过Delphi组件(如ADO、FireDAC)执行查询和操作。结合TreeView和SQL,步骤包括设置数据库连接、编写SQL查询、绑定数据到TreeView节点、自定义节点显示以及响应用户交互。
Delphi编程中TreeView控件与SQL数据库结合的应用示例
相关推荐
VB中Treeview控件的树形结构详解
1)在ACCESS中设置Treeview控件的名称属性为“Treeview" 2)在ACCESS中设置Imagelist控件的名称属性为“Image" 3)双击Imagelist控件,在弹出的设置框中选择“Images",单击“Insert",将图像插入到Imagelist控件中。
Access
3
2024-07-21
TreeView控件数据绑定:连接Access数据库
利用 Access 数据库中的数据资源,我们可以实现 TreeView 控件和 TreeNode 的数据绑定,将数据库信息清晰地呈现在树状结构中。
Access
3
2024-05-19
ADO数据库控件与数据绑定控件中Connection对象的应用
4.Connection对象的使用。 (1)设置connectionstring连接属性。 (2)使用open方法建立连接。 (3)使用close方法断开连接。
SQLServer
0
2024-09-14
Delphi连接Oracle控件ODAC的配置与应用
随着Delphi技术的发展,使用Oracle数据库的需求日益增加。ODAC是连接Delphi与Oracle的重要组件,安装和配置正确的ODAC版本对于保证系统稳定性和性能至关重要。将详细介绍如何安装和配置ODAC,以及在Delphi中如何有效地利用它来操作Oracle数据库。
Oracle
1
2024-07-27
Delphi与SQL Server数据库互操作示例
探讨了使用Delphi编程语言与Microsoft SQL Server数据库进行交互的示例项目。Delphi作为强大的面向对象的Pascal编程环境,与SQL Server数据库的连接与操作展示了如何使用Delphi的TADOConnection, TADOCommand和TADODataset组件进行连接配置、SQL查询执行及结果集处理。通过参数化查询和事务处理,开发者能够有效地管理数据库操作。
SQLServer
0
2024-08-29
Delphi多用途数据库控件
许多人都反映Delphi缺乏一种可以将任意数据存入数据库的控件。尽管编写代码实现这一功能并不困难,但拥有一个控件会更加便捷。现在,我终于抽出时间开发了这样一个控件,用户可以直接拖放使用。它支持将各种数据类型写入数据库,还可以从数据库中读取到流,或者直接保存为文件。此外,我还加入了对常见图像格式(如JPG或GIF)的处理功能,使得图像保存和显示操作更加方便。
MySQL
2
2024-07-30
活用TREEVIEW控件: 实战技巧分享
TREEVIEW控件实战技巧
TREEVIEW控件在界面设计中扮演着重要角色,它可以清晰地展示层次结构数据。以下是一些使用TREEVIEW控件的实用技巧:
节点操作:
添加、删除和修改节点,构建动态的树形结构。
通过代码展开或收缩节点,控制信息展示的层次。
数据绑定:
将TREEVIEW与数据库或其他数据源连接,实现数据的动态加载和更新。
灵活运用数据绑定,根据数据结构自动生成树形结构。
自定义样式:
调整节点图标、字体和颜色,打造个性化的视觉效果。
通过自定义绘制,实现更复杂的节点展示效果。
事件处理:
捕捉节点选中、展开等事件,实现交互功能。
利用事件处理机制,实现节点拖拽等高级操作。
通过灵活运用这些技巧,可以构建功能丰富、用户友好的界面,提升应用的用户体验。
Access
5
2024-04-30
VB和DELPHI中ADO控件的事务管理应用
事务控制是数据库应用系统中的关键技术之一。首先介绍了事务控制的基本概念及其在微软的ActiveX数据对象(ADO)中的实现。随后,通过一个具体的实例详细演示了在Visual Basic(VB)和DELPHI中如何利用ADO进行事务控制。
SQLServer
0
2024-09-16
VB数据库编程中的窗体或控件区域
鼠标事件触发:
鼠标进入区域:MouseEnter
鼠标在区域内移动:MouseMove
鼠标按下:MouseDown
鼠标抬起:MouseUp
滚动鼠标滑轮:MouseWheel
鼠标悬停在区域:MouseHover
鼠标离开区域:MouseLeave
Access
5
2024-05-01